The UK Biochips Market was valued at $661.4 Million in 2025 and projected to reach to $1055.9 Million by 2030, representing a compound annual growth rate of 9.8%. The UK biochips market is poised for sustained expansion through 2030, driven by increasing adoption in clinical diagnostics, drug discovery acceleration, and personalized medicine applications.

      UK: BIOCHIPS MARKET, BY END USER, 2023–2030

      Segment20232024202520262027202820292030CAGR (%)
      ACADEMIC & RESEARCH INSTITUTES59.164.570.47784.191.9100.6110.29.4
      BIOTECHNOLOGY & PHARMACEUTICAL COMPANIES305.4336.3370.4408.3450496.5548.360610.3
      CONTRACT RESEARCH ORGANIZATIONS36.340.344.849.855.461.768.776.611.3
      HOSPITALS & DIAGNOSTIC CENTERS125135.1146.1158170.9185200.5217.58.3
      OTHER END USERS2527.229.632.335.138.341.745.69
      TOTAL551603.5661.4725.4795.5873.4959.91055.99.8

      Market Definition

      The biochips market refers to miniaturized analytical platforms integrating biological probes or microfluidic components that allow simultaneous or rapid analysis of DNA, RNA, proteins, metabolites, or tissues. They are fabricated as microarrays, microfluidic cartridges, or tissue arrays and used in diagnostics, genomics, proteomics, drug discovery, and pathology research. These biochips enable high-throughput screening, providing faster, more efficient testing methods, and are critical in applications such as personalized medicine, disease detection, and environmental monitoring. With advances in technology, biochips are becoming increasingly versatile, supporting the development of novel diagnostics and therapeutic solutions across multiple sectors.
